Jeffrey Rhoney | The Importance of Networking

 Networking plays a vital role in advancing a carpentry career. Experienced carpenters like Jeffrey Rhoney underscore that building relationships with industry professionals, fellow tradespeople, and potential clients can open doors to new opportunities and collaborations. Joining professional organizations, attending trade shows, and participating in community events can provide valuable networking opportunities for aspiring carpenters.

 

Additionally, seeking mentorship from experienced carpenters can be instrumental in developing skills and gaining insights into the industry. Mentors can offer guidance on best practices, share valuable resources, and help navigate the challenges of building a career. By actively engaging in networking and mentorship opportunities, aspiring carpenters can enhance their professional growth and increase their chances of success in the field.
